From the Rolls-Royce experimental archive: a quarter of a million communications from Rolls-Royce, 1906 to 1960's. Documents from the Sir Henry Royce Memorial Foundation (SHRMF).
Request to design locks for float chamber lids on chassis, similar to those on the 'Eagle' Aero engines.

X8080 BY/SS.{S. Smith} c. HS.{Lord Ernest Hives - Chair} G.E. BY6/H.{Arthur M. Hanbury - Head Complaints} 19.4.26. LOCKS FOR FLOAT CHAMBER LID.{A. J. Lidsey} ------------------------- Will you kindly get out schemes for locking the float chamber lids on both chassis, in a similar manner to that adopted on the "Eagle" Aero engines, as we have had one or two instances of the lids working loose. E.{Mr Elliott - Chief Engineer} suggests we should get out designs. When same are ready, I propose to submit same to West WitteringHenry Royce's home town, and upon getting consent, go ahead at once. . BY.{R.W. Bailey - Chief Engineer} | ||
